Raven Golf Club pays its employees an average of $93,898 per year. The average salary at Raven Golf Club range from $82,426 to $106,550 per year.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ills, and location.
The salary at Raven Golf Club is higher than the similar company. The average annual salary at Raven Golf Club is $93,898, or an hourly wage of $45, in comparison to Tuck's Inc which pays $90,069 per year or $43 per hour.
An Assistant General Manager at Raven Golf Club typically earns an average annual base salary of around $174,996, with a general range of $146,991 to $205,579.
